Faithia Williams Makes First Emotional Post Following Mother’s Burial

jolaoso babajide
Last updated: March 10, 2026 8:12 am
jolaoso babajide
Published: March 10, 2026
Share
SHARE

Nollywood actress Faithia Williams has made her first post following her mother’s burial.

Newsunplug reported last month the Yoruba actress lost her mother on the eve of her 55th birthday party. She said the reality of her passing hasn’t fully sunk in because she was her cheerleader, prayer warrior, best friend, and gist partner.

Faithia Williams post after mother's burial

On Saturday, March 7th, the actress’s mother was finally laid to rest on Saturday, March 7th, with a few of her colleagues in attendance.

Faithia Williams post after mother's burial

Taking to her Instagram page, she shared a clip from her mother’s burial, noting how she has finally gone to rest. The movie star bade her mother farewell, telling her to rest well.

“My mother has finally gone to rest, IYAMI OWON, sun ree ooo”.
